Shavuot 2019

According to my best calculations and understanding of the relevant Scriptures, this Sunday (1st day of the week) 16 June 2019 will bring us to Shavuot (Pentecost).

Historically it can be stated with relative authority that the giving of The Torah by YHWH our Elohim at Mt. Sinai, and as recorded for us in Ex. 19 forward was at the time of Shavuot, and of course we have the well know and documented event that occurred in Yerusaliem 10 days after the Ascension of Yeshua (Acts 2).

It is not my intention to go into any deep and serious exegeses regarding this Moed (Lev. 23:15-22), but rather to look at the approach we as individuals should be attempting to achieve during this whole process of counting the 50 day Omar and leading up this Moed.

However we often get caught up in the hurly-burly affairs of this life with all it's trappings and religiosity and forget about the massive importance of Shavuot and the 50 day Counting of The Omar leading up to auspicious Moed.

Looking at Ex. 19:3-11 we are told that YHWH Elohim (The Creator) posed Covenant questions of betrothal to His People, Yisrael, and that they accepted these Covenant proposals and that this pleased YHWH.

We also see in this portion of Scripture that YHWH required that His people be set apart for three days (the third day being Shavuot), so that they, the People, could meet with YHWH - and here we see the deliverance of The Torah, The Written Instructions of YHWH.

Fast forward one and a half Millennia and we arrive at Acts 2 and here we have the outpouring of The Ruach HaKodesh (a visual aid to the fact that we cannot apply The Torah without The Ruach and we cannot have The Ruach without The Torah), but here is what I am wanting to address for this Shavuot if I may:

Shavuot is both a National as well as a personal commitment to YHWH and I think far to often we pass this Marriage Moed off as "something that happened to Yisrael a long time ago" and forego the massive importance that it plays in each of our lives on an individual level every day of our lives for eternity if we claim to be Children of The Most High redeemed through Messiah Yeshua. 

Allow me to now refer to the writings penned by a person who was very prominent at this Acts event, an event which turned his entire life and personality upside down - Kephas also referred to as Peter - and for this I turn to 2 Peter 1:2-11. I arrived at this portion of Scripture whilst reading a blog forwarded to me by a Christian Pastor and I suppose that this blog that I am posting and which I shall send to him, is not only for those of the Hebraic persuasion celebrating the Torah understanding and application of The Moed of Shavuot but also a partial answer in reaction to the Christian Pastor's take of this portion of Scripture to which he referred.

We see that Kephas, obviously under the leading of The very Ruach which was poured out on him at the Acts Shavuot writes in his 2 epistle and in Chapter 1 verse 2 

Verse 2 - May grace (unmerited favour) and shalom (peace, assurance, provisions, protection, restoration) be yours in full measure, as you come to a full knowledge (Hebraicly a Covenant intimacy - marriage relationship) of Elohim and Yeshua our Adonai.

Verse 3 - Elohim's power (dunamis - power, force (dynamite) has given us everything we need for life and goodness, through our knowing (Hebraicly a Covenant intimacy - marriage relationship) the One who called (kaleao - carries the meaning of both inviting and summoning) us to His own glory and goodness.

Verse 4 - By these (the grace, shalom) He has given us valuable and superlatively great promises (power and knowledge through Yeshua), so that through them you might come to share in Elohim's nature (begin in our own nature and lives to walk and live without sin - breaking Torah) and escape the corruption which evil desires have brought into the world.

Verse 5- For this very reason (having been given Grace and Shalom leading to Power and Knowledge), try your hardest to furnish (support and nourish) your faith (pisitis - Covenant Fidelity / Covenant (Torah) Application) with goodness (strength or valour, virtue and praise), goodness with knowledge (Hebraicly a Covenant intimacy - marriage relationship),

Verse 6 - knowledge with self-control (continual and masterful temperance), self-control with perseverance (patience, endurance), perseverance with godliness (devotion, dedication, sincerity, faithfully)

Verse 7 - godliness with brotherly affection (kindness, affection), brotherly affection with LOVE (G26 - Agape LOVE, Divine Love from YHWH Elohim).

Verse 8 - For if you have these qualities in abundance, they keep you from being barren and unfruitful (See Gal. 5:22-23) in the knowledge of our Messiah Yeshua. (Hebraicly a Covenant intimacy - marriage relationship)

Verse 9 - Indeed whoever lacks them (these fruit beginning with FAITH pisitis - Covenant Fidelity / Covenant (Torah) Application) is blind, so shortsighted that he forgets that his past sins have been washed away.

Verse 10 - Therefore, brothers, try even harder to make your being called and chosen a certainty. For if you keep doing this (applying verses 2-7 above in FAITH), YOU WILL NEVER STUMBLE.

Verse 11 - Thus you will be generously supplied with everything you need to enter The Eternal Kingdom (See Mat. 6:33) of our Master and Deliver, Yeshua the Messiah.

We see the development of a pattern in the verses above which begins with GRACE and end with G26 Divine Agape LOVE and in between we see certain fruit of The Ruach, but what is required from us initially is to attempt with all our heart, our soul and our might to bolster FAITH - the application and commitment to His Torah, Commandments (John 14:15-17).

The entire process is began with YHWH and ends with YHWH
